What is the assignment of mortgage form?

The assignment of mortgage form is a legal document that transfers the rights and obligations of a mortgage from one lender to another. This form is essential in real estate transactions, especially when a property is sold or refinanced. The assignment ensures that the new lender has the authority to collect payments and enforce the terms of the mortgage. It is important to understand that the assignment of mortgage does not change the terms of the loan itself; it simply changes who holds the mortgage rights.

Key elements of the assignment of mortgage form

Several key elements must be included in the assignment of mortgage form to ensure its validity:

  • Parties involved: The form should clearly identify the original lender (assignor) and the new lender (assignee).
  • Property description: A detailed description of the property being mortgaged must be included, typically referencing the address and legal description.
  • Effective date: The date on which the assignment takes effect should be specified to avoid any confusion regarding the timeline.
  • Signatures: Both parties must sign the document to validate the assignment. Notarization may also be required in some jurisdictions.

Steps to complete the assignment of mortgage form

Completing the assignment of mortgage form involves several straightforward steps:

  1. Gather necessary information, including the original mortgage documents and details about the property.
  2. Fill out the assignment form with accurate information regarding the assignor, assignee, and property description.
  3. Ensure that both parties review the document for accuracy and completeness.
  4. Sign the form in the presence of a notary if required by state law.
  5. File the completed form with the appropriate local government office, such as the county recorder’s office, to make the assignment public.

Legal use of the assignment of mortgage form

The assignment of mortgage form is legally binding once it is executed correctly. It must comply with state laws and regulations governing real estate transactions. Failure to properly execute or file the assignment can lead to complications, such as disputes over mortgage payments or the inability to enforce the mortgage terms. Understanding the legal implications and ensuring compliance with local laws is crucial for both lenders and borrowers.

State-specific rules for the assignment of mortgage form

Each state may have specific rules and requirements regarding the assignment of mortgage form. These can include:

  • Notarization requirements: Some states require notarization for the assignment to be valid.
  • Filing fees: There may be fees associated with filing the assignment with local authorities.
  • Time limits: Certain states may impose deadlines for filing the assignment after it has been executed.

It is essential to consult local regulations or seek legal advice to ensure compliance with state-specific rules.

Examples of using the assignment of mortgage form

Common scenarios where the assignment of mortgage form is utilized include:

  • Refinancing: When a homeowner refinances their mortgage, the original lender may assign the mortgage to the new lender.
  • Property sale: If a property is sold, the seller may need to assign the existing mortgage to the buyer’s lender.
  • Transfer of ownership: In cases of inheritance or transfer of property ownership, the assignment of mortgage form may be necessary to update the mortgage holder.
